  3. Yeah, everyone will be in the double elimination tournament bracket. We are using pool play before hand to determine seeding into the bracket. And to be able to guarantee more games for everyone attending. Since it's our first year and we aren't looking at an absolute ton of attendees, I saw no reason to exclude anyone from the bracket. If you do want to attend, but are unable to make the pool play before hand, you will just be seeded at the bottom.

  12. Tecmo Indy I It is my pleasure to announce the inaugural Tecmo Indy I! Date: June 20, 2015 Place: Books&Brews,9402 Uptown Drive, Indianapolis, IN 46256 Time: Sign In Open 11-1 p.m. Play kicks off around 1:30 p.m. Registration Cost: $20. Prizes: Cash prizes to top finishers. Additional prizes TBD. Cash prizes depend on number of attendees. Format: Single-elimination SNES Tourney followed by an NES tourney with pool play seeding everyone into a double-elimination tournament. Rules: Tecmo Madison rule set. Please visit tecmomadison.com/Rules for details. Full credit of rules goes to the Madison staff. Open to anyone and everyone regardless of skill level.
